Why it was recalled
Sunny Pine Farm of Twisp, Washington is voluntarily recalling Organic Chevre due to possible improper pasteurization.
The exact product
Organic Chevre sold at Farmer's Market in plastic 6 oz tubs, vacuum-sealed with lid and label on top of tub, Sunny Pine Farm brand. Product also sold to in 2 lbs. and 3 lbs. to restaurant. Product is labeled in parts: "***Organic Goat Dairy***Chevre***SUNNY PINE FARM***6 oz***Pasteurized Organic Goat Milk, Salt, Rennet, and Culture***Keep refrigerated***Handcrafted in Twisp, Washington 98856***.

Original FDA code information
Expiration dates of products sold to non-restaurant consignees: 10/16/2013. Expiration dates of products sold to restaurants: 10/23/13 and 11/5/13. Chevre cheese products sold at Methow Valley Farmers Market (aka Twisp Farmers Market) between 7/27/13 and 10/12/13 were NOT labeled with an expiration date.

Where it was distributed
Finished products were sold in WA only
